feat: overhaul SplitDrawingForm — EntityView, draggable feature handles, UI fixes

- Replace raw Panel with EntityView (via SplitPreview subclass) for proper
  zoom-to-point, middle-button pan, and double-buffered rendering
- Add draggable handles for tab/spike positions along split lines; positions
  flow through to WeldGapTabSplit and SpikeGrooveSplit via SplitLine.FeaturePositions
- Fix OK/Cancel buttons hidden off-screen by putting them in a bottom-docked panel
- Fix DrawControl not invalidating on resize
- Swap plate Width/Length label order, default edge spacing to 0.5
- Rename tab labels: Tab Width→Tab Length, Tab Height→Weld Gap, default count 2
- Spike depth now calculated (read-only), groove depth means positioning depth
  beyond spike tip (default 0.125), converted to total depth internally
- Set entity layers visible so EntityView renders them
